Looking for warm weather? Then head to Sun Valley in July, when the average temperature is 62.6 °F, and the highest can go up to 80.6 °F. The coldest month, on the other hand, is January, when it can get as cold as 5 °F, with an average temperature of 17.6 °F. You’re likely to see more rain in December, when precipitation is around 2.5″. In contrast, August is usually the driest month of the year in Sun Valley, with an average rainfall of 0.7″.

How to Get to Sun Valley

Plane

When flying to Sun Valley, you’ll arrive at Hailey Sun Valley-Friedman (SUN), which is located 13 miles from the city center. Airlines that fly from the United States to Sun Valley include United Airlines, Alaska Airlines and Aeromexico. The shortest domestic flight to Sun Valley departs from Seattle and takes around 1h 31m.

Car

Another option to get to Sun Valley is to pick up a car rental from Boise, which is about 93 miles from Sun Valley. You’ll find branches of Enterprise Rent-A-Car and Budget, among others, in Boise.
